Grand Final

Carlton defeated Collingwood 11.16 (82) to 11.11 (77), in front of a crowd of 112845 people. (For an explanation of scoring see Australian rules football).

Notes

* The leading goalkicker was Kelvin Templeton of Footscray with 91 goals
* The Brownlow Medal was won by Peter Moore
* The record for greatest winning margin was set twice during 1979.
**In Round 4, Collingwood defeated St Kilda by 178 points, breaking the record set sixty years earlier, in the 1919 VFL season by South Melbourne.
**Collingwood's new record was broken only three months later in Round 17, when Fitzroy defeated Melbourne by 190 points, a record which has yet to be broken at the end of 2007.
* Fitzroy's score of 36.22 (238) in the same game also set the record for highest score in a VFL/AFL game. This beat the record set by Footscray in the 1978 VFL season by twenty-five points, and remained the record for 13 years (i.e., until the 1992 AFL season).
